`

多个js文件,只加载了其中一部分

    博客分类:
  • web
 
阅读更多

项目中时常碰到一些稀奇古怪的问题,比如在jsp中加载多个js文件,

  <script type="text/javascript" src="../ext/bootstrap.js"/>
  <script type="text/javascript" src="../ext/locale/ext-lang-zh_CN.js"></script>
  <script type="text/javascript" src="a.js"></script>
  <script type="text/javascript" src="b.js"></script>
  <script type="text/javascript" src="c.js"></script>

通过在火狐中观察,ext-lang-zh_CN.js文件没有加载;

 

  <script type="text/javascript" src="../ext/bootstrap.js"></script>
  <script type="text/javascript" src="../ext/locale/ext-lang-zh_CN.js"></script>
  <script type="text/javascript" src="a.js"></script>
  <script type="text/javascript" src="b.js"></script>
  <script type="text/javascript" src="c.js"></script>

结果改成上面的形式,则js全部加载成功;

 

统一改成下面形式只加载了bootstrap.js文件

  <script type="text/javascript" src="../ext/bootstrap.js"/>
  <script type="text/javascript" src="../ext/locale/ext-lang-zh_CN.js"/>
  <script type="text/javascript" src="a.js"/>
  <script type="text/javascript" src="b.js"/>
  <script type="text/javascript" src="c.js"/>

经验:在jsp中引入js文件最好是采用<script></script>形式引入。

分享到:
评论

相关推荐

    加载更多JS代码loadmore-master.zip

    最简单的就是给一个加载更多的按钮,实现假分页加载更多,也就是页面上是全部的数据,只是按照页面显示要求,自己规定显示部分范围,其余隐藏。如果还有数据,点击下加载更多,继续拉几条数据;直到没有更多数据了...

    Javascript 延迟加载图片

    之前在做一个图片浏览效果时,要看后面的小图必须等到前面的加载完,而且大图的位置是在大量的小图后面,导致大图要等到小图都加载完才能显示,为了解决这个问题,就想到了Lazyload效果。 现在很多网站都用了类似的...

    java swfupload 多文件上传js

    一个Js库:SWFUpload.js Flash控件: swfupload.swf JavaScript事件处理程序 下面分别介绍这4个部分 初始化和设置 初始化通常在window.onload事件中进行,通过SWFUpload的构造函数来完成。 方法一: 复制代码 var ...

    ztree树的部分js文件

    zTree 是一个依靠 jQuery 实现的多功能 “树插件”。优异的性能、灵活的配置、多种功能的组合是 zTree 最大优点。 zTree 是开源免费的... 在一个页面内可同时生成多个 Tree 实例 简单的参数配置实现 灵活多变的功能

    load.js:JavaScript jscss、jsonpajax、同步加载器

    加载.js JavaScript js/css、jsonp/ajax、同步/异步加载器这个库使您可以完全控制为您的 Web 应用程序加载脚本和 css 文件。 您无需在 HTML 页面中使用一堆“脚本”和“链接”标签,而是将它们全部定义在一个地方。 ...

    DIY的JS延迟加载图片的插件

    今天共享一个DIY的利用JS来延迟加载图片的插件。 大概的实现方式是:页面的定义元素img时,将src统一替换成自定义的一个属性名,如叫“originalSrc”,然后利用JS把给img的src设置为一个定义好的等待图片,然后在...

    Node.js-仿@Maxwin-z的XListView库主要功能是下拉刷新和上拉加载更多功能

    仿@Maxwin-z的XListView库,主要功能是下拉刷新和上拉加载更多功能,并且添加了一部分Header可以默认显示,并通过demo给出了itme悬停的方案。实现效果跟支付宝首页比较类似,下拉刷新的Header上面还有一个布局,往上...

    jquery-1.4.2库文件

    不过,如果引用多个js,就要插入多段的script。Google也提供了相应的办法,那就是google load。我们只需要在页面里引用一个js文件,就可以根据需要实时加载用到的js库了。 首先在页头部分加入以下这行代码: ...

    大名鼎鼎SWFUpload- Flash+JS 上传

    此文件选择对话框是可以设置允许用户选择一个单独的文件或者是多个文件。 选择的的文件类型也是可以被限制的,因此用户只能选择指定的适当的文件,例如*.jgp;*.gif。 当选定文件以后,每个文件都会被验证和处理。...

    Javascript/CSS 多文件代码合并、安全压缩、优化(PHP版)

    此程序会自动去除 注释,并且会对文件名进行安全检测、去重复、存在判定等操作,只允许 .js/.css 文件,并且不允许包含远程文件。 环境要求: &gt;= PHP 5 压缩多个 js 方法: [removed] [removed] 压缩多个 ...

    js上拉加载源码采用jq编写

    在实际开发中难免少不了,上拉加载数据功能模块,现在大部分框架可能也有这个功能模块,但这里面存在一个学习成本问题,要花费开发人员时间和精力,考虑大家的便利性,我封装了一个上拉加载的轮子,代码不多

    Javascript模块化编程(三)require.js的用法及功能介绍

    这个系列的第一部分和第...后来,代码越来越多,一个文件不够了,必须分成多个文件,依次加载。下面的网页代码,相信很多人都见过。 代码如下: [removed][removed] [removed][removed] [removed][removed] &lt;script s

    原生JS实现图片懒加载之页面性能优化

    我们可以一次性加载全部的图片,但是考虑到用户有可能只浏览部分图片。所以我们需要对图片加载进行优化,只加载浏览器窗口内的图片,当用户滚动时,再加载更多的图片。这种加载图片的方式叫做图片懒加载,又叫做按需...

    JAVA上百实例源码以及开源项目

     用JAVA开发的一个小型的目录监视系统,系统会每5秒自动扫描一次需要监视的目录,可以用来监视目录中文件大小及文件增减数目的变化。 Java日期选择控件完整源代码 14个目标文件 内容索引:JAVA源码,系统相关,日历,...

    解决webview 第二次调用loadUrl页面不刷新的问题

    一个需求,当点击Button按钮时,希望加载另一个Url。 以下方法可以成功! @Override public void onClick(View view) { webview.loadUrl(url); webview.loadUrl( [removed][removed].reload( true ) ); } 亲测...

    原生JS实现图片懒加载(lazyload)实例

    图片懒加载也是比较常见的一种性能优化的方法,最近在用vue做一个新闻列表的客户端时也用到了,这里就简单介绍下实现原理和部分代码。 实现原理 加载页面的时候,图片一直都是流量大头,针对图片的性能方法也挺多的...

    Ajax 动态载入html页面后不能执行其中的js快速解决方法

    有一个公用页面需要在多个页面调用,其中涉及到部分js已经写在了公用页面中,通过ajax加载该页面后无法执行其中的js。 解决思路 1. 采用附加一个iframe的方法去执行js,为我等代码洁癖者所不齿。 2. 使用[removed]...

    cache-require-source:在模块中缓存加载的源需要加快下一个应用程序加载

    此后的每个应用程序启动都将重用此缓存以避免加载多个文件。 适用于 。 去做 仅缓存第 3 方 javascript 源 如果 package.json 中的依赖项发生变化,则缓存无效 小字 作者:Gleb Bahmutov :copyright: 2015 许可证...

    懒人原生js tab标签切换效果

    单独为了它你还要为页面加载一个jQuery插件,想必是极痛苦的 所有很多时候,jQuery特效也不是万能的,偶尔来个原生的js效果也是必须的 今天无聊,特意写了一个原生javascript切换效果,需要的童鞋可以拿来...

    svg-url-loader:一个Webpack加载器,将SVG文件作为utf-8编码的DataUrl字符串加载

    svg-url-loader 一个Webpack加载程序,它将SVG文件作为utf-8编码的DataUrl字符串加载。 现有的始终对data-uri进行Base64编码。 由于SVG内容是人类可读的xml字符串,因此不必强制使用base64编码。 相反,人们只能逃离...

Global site tag (gtag.js) - Google Analytics